Wine: This magnum of Margaux from Château Mille Roses presents pretty ripe red and black fruits, elegant woody notes as well as sweet and melted tannins. A beautiful intensity full of finesse emanates from this bottle which, thanks to its large format, can be kept for a few years longer than its little sister. Accessible in its youth (don't hesitate to decant it then), this bottle will be able to evolve positively over more than 20 years and will then give you access to tertiary aromas such as undergrowth, leather and humus. Capacity: 150cl
Type: Red Wine
Grape varieties: 70% Cabernet Sauvignon, 30% Merlot
AOC: Margaux
Lay Down: Drink now through 2038
Operating temperature: 16-18°C
The estate : Created in 1999 by Sophie and David Faure , the Château Mille Roses has 9.5 hectares grown organically since 2010. Cabernet-Sauvignon remains the majority within the estate and is accompanied by Merlot as well as a parcel of Petit Verdot. Theaging takes place in oak barrelsandismanaged to emphasize and not dominate the fruit. The very qualitative terroir of the farm is mainly composed of gravel and sand. The property also has very prestigious neighbours, its vines being surrounded by those of Château Giscours and Cantemerle, both Grands Crus Classés. A high quality property to discover!
